Improved Clear Sky Model from In Situ Observations and Spatial Distribution of Aerosol Optical Depth for Satellite-Derived Solar Irradiance over the Korean Peninsula

In solar resource assessment, the climatological environment of target area is objectively quantified by cloudiness or clear sky index, which defined as ratio global horizontal irradiance to insolation. The model calculates incoming on ground surface considering several atmospheric parameters such water vapor and aerosol optical depth. Aerosol optical depths (AOD) and Angström coefficients over Europe were retrieved using data from the ATSR-2 radiometer on board the ESA satellite ERS-2, for August 1997. Taking advantage of the nadir and forward view of the ATSR-2, the dual view algorithm was used over land to eliminate the influence of the surface reflection.
